About Stoever's Dam Park

Stoever's Dam Park campground offers an urban camping experience with a surprising natural twist. This city-owned park provides a unique blend of recreational amenities and rustic camping opportunities just minutes from downtown Lebanon.

The campground features 14 sites, including 7 with electrical hookups, nestled near a 23.5-acre lake. While the camping area lacks dense forest cover, it compensates with easy access to fishing, canoeing, and a 1.5-mile lakeside trail. The Nature Barn, a restored 125-year-old structure, adds educational value with displays on local flora and fauna.

Located on the northeast edge of Lebanon, Pennsylvania, Stoever's Dam Park serves as a convenient base for exploring the Lebanon Valley. The campground's proximity to town amenities, coupled with its natural setting, makes it ideal for anglers, families, and those seeking a quick outdoor escape without venturing far from urban conveniences.
